Important Safety Information
Important information is highlighted by these terms:
WARNING: Danger for patient or operating staff.
CAUTION: Information for preventing damage to the product.
ATTENTION: Important operating instructions.
WARNING
• This device is intended for use by trained and certified healthcare professionals such as doctors, nurses, and therapists, or by those under their
guidance. Use only after consulting with your doctor and receiving proper training from a trained healthcare professional.
• Intended Use: The AS-1001D Suction Pump’s intended use is to remove bodily fluids from a patient’s airway or respiratory system. Using this device
for any purpose other than the stated intended use may result in injury to the patient or operator.
• To ensure proper hygiene, collection container, inline filter, suction tubing, and intermediate tubing must only be used by the same patient. Do
not use these accessories across multiple patients. Do not attempt to sterilize these accessories for use across multiple patients. Failure to abide by
these warnings may result in infection or cross contamination between patients.
• Fluid collected in the collection container must be disposed of according to local regulations, institution policy (as applicable), and the instructions
of a certified healthcare professional.
• Do not use this device with accessories which have not been approved by the distributor or manufacturer of the product. Use of unapproved
accessories may cause harm to the patient and will void the warranty coverage for this device.
• Suction catheters are not included with this device and must be purchased separately, in accordance with the instructions of a trained
and certified physician or healthcare professional. Only use disposable, single-use, sterile suction catheters compliant with local and/or national laws,
regulations, and directives. In the EU, only use suction catheters that are labeled with the CE mark, are MDD-compliant, and have received market
authorization from a certified notified body. Failure to do so could cause harm to the patient.
• To avoid the risk of infection, always use sterile single-use suction catheters. After use, immediately dispose of the suction catheter in accordance
with local regulations, institution policy (as applicable), and the instructions of a certified healthcare professional. Do not attempt to re-use or
re-sterilize suction catheters.
• During suction, do not exceed the maximum vacuum pressure recommended by your healthcare professional or physician.
• Never open, disassemble, or modify the device, or any accessories included with the device.
• Device is MR Unsafe. This device must not be used in an MRI environment. Further the device shall not be placed or operated in the following
environments or near the following devices: CT, diathermy machine, RFID transmitters, electromagnetic security systems (such as metal detectors).
To reduce the risk of burns, electrocution, fire or injury to persons:
• Do not store the device where it can fall or be pulled into a tub, sink, or other water source.
• Never place the device in water or other liquids. If it falls in water, do not reach for it. Unplug immediately.
• Never leave the device unattended when switched on.
• The device must stand upright during use.
• Do not use this device to suction explosive, flammable, or corrosive liquids.
• Keep the power cord away from hot surfaces.
• Keep the plug and ON/OFF switch away from moisture.
• Never use the device (1) while bathing, showering, or close to a water source (2) when tired or not fully alert (3) outdoors (4) at high room
temperatures (5) in an environment where there is a risk of explosion.
• Close supervision is required when this device is used for, with, or near children or infants. This device should not be operated by children.
• Do not operate where aerosol (spray) products are being used or where oxygen is being administered in a closed environment such as an oxygen
reservoir.
• Never operate this product if: (1) It has a damaged power cord or plug. (2) It is not working properly. (3) It has been dropped or damaged. (4) It has
been dropped into water. Send the product to an authorized service center for examination and repair. Never open or disassemble the unit yourself.
CAUTION
• Before plugging in the device, please check that the local power supply is the same as the specified voltage mentioned on the device. The voltage
sticker can be found at the bottom of the device.
• Always unplug the device after use. Never pull the plug out of the mains socket by pulling on the power cable.
• This machine is an oil-less suction pump and does not require any lubrication. Do not add any lubricants to this machine.
• This aspirator is not suitable for prolonged continuous use.
• Do not disassemble the unit; there are no user serviceable components within the device.
ATTENTION
• Prior to first use, carefully unpack the unit and check for transportation damage. In case of damage, do not use.
• The device creates a negative pressure (vacuum) that draws fluids through a disposable suction catheter that is connected by suction tubing to a
collection container. The suctioned fluids are then trapped in the collection container for proper disposal.
• This aspirator is suitable for use at home, in hospitals or clinics, and in nursing homes.
• Before using any approved third party accessories with this device, check to make sure they are compatible - that all fittings are tight. Loose fittings
may degrade the performance of this device and may prevent the device from operating at its optimal level.

Intended Use
The AS-1001D Suction Pump’s intended use is to remove bodily fluids from a patient’s airway or respiratory system.
Device Description
The AS-1001D suction pump is a portable AC-powered suction pump. The AS-1001D suction pump creates a negative pressure (vacuum) that draws
fluids through a disposable suction catheter that is connected by suction tubing to a collection container. The suctioned fluids are then trapped in the
collection container for proper disposal. The device must only be used on the order of a physician. If practiced outside of the hospital setting, the
care giver must be trained by a certified healthcare professional and the training must be recorded and documented. The AS-1001D suction pump
consists of an on/off switch, a pump unit, a power cord, a collection container, relief valve, pressure adjustment knob, pressure gauge, inline filter,
long intermediate tubing, short intermediate tubing, and suction tubing. Disposable suction catheters are not packaged with this device and must be
purchased separately. Use only sterile single-use suction catheters that are compliant with local and/or national laws, regulations, and directives.
In the EU, only use suction catheters that are labeled with the CE mark, are MDD-compliant, and have received market authorization from a certified
notified body.
Service Life
The expected service life of the device is four years.

Product Specification
Power requirement: AC 220-240V 50Hz
Max airflow: 48 l/min
Vacuum: 0 - 620 mmHg
Dimensions: L33 x W16.5 x H20 cm
Weight: 8 kg / 17.6 lbs
Collection canister capacity: 800 ml
Power cord length: 185 cm
Operating temp: 5 - 40 ˚C
Operating relative humidity: 0 - 93%
Operating atmospheric pressure: 10.2 - 15.4 psi (70 - 106 kPa)
Storage and transport temp: -25 - 70 ˚C
Storage and transport humidity: 0 - 93%
Storage atmospheric pressure: 7.3 - 15.4 psi (50 - 106 kPa)

Operation
Operator must wear disposable single-use gloves when operating and handling unit.
Place the machine on a flat and stable surface. WARNING: Inspect power cord. If power cord is frayed or damaged, do not use device.
Prior to use, inspect collection container and tubing for cracks or leaks, and replace all damaged accessories immediately. Do not use device if
accessories are damaged.
Place the collection container securely into the collection container holder.
Connect the inline filter into the inlet, ensuring that the“FLUID SIDE” is facing upwards. Connect one end of the intermediate tubing
to the inline filter on the“FLUID SIDE”. Connect the other end of the intermediate tubing to the“vacuum port”on collection container lid.
Connect one end of suction tubing to the “patient port”on the collection container lid.
Check all connections and make sure they are secure and tight. A poor connection could result in an air leak that diminishes pump performance.
Insert the plug into a wall (mains) outlet with a voltage matching the device’s requirements. (See device label located on the underbelly of the
device for device’s voltage requirements.) Turn the power switch on.
Adjust the unit to its desired suction level before beginning patient suction.
a. Create a vacuum by completely blocking the open end of the suction tubing.
b. Adjust the vacuum regulator knob until you reach the desired vacuum level displayed on the vacuum gauge.
c. As long as the open end of the suction tubing remains completely blocked, the vacuum level should remain steady.
For suctioning of an adult airway, experts recommend a vacuum level between 100-150 mmHg.
Once unit is set to the desired vacuum pressure, attach disposable suction catheter to the open end of the suction tubing.
Proceed with suctioning as instructed by your healthcare professional. Remove suction catheter from patient immediately after suctioning.
After each use, turn off the power switch and unplug the unit.

CAUTION
• Make sure the power switch is turned off before inserting or removing the plug.
• The unit should not be left running for over 1 hour continuously. If the machine has been operating continuously for 1 hour, please turn off the
power for at least 30 minutes before turning back on.
• Keep the machine and relevant accessories dry. Avoid direct sun exposure during storage.
WARNING: Never operate the unit without the inline filter.

Maintenance & Repair
• Replace the inline filter if the fibrous material in the filter is wet or in the case of a collection container overflow. With the vacuum regulator fully
closed and the tubing disconnected from the “Fluid Side” of the filter (filter open to atmosphere), a vacuum reading in excess of 50 mmHg on the
gauge indicates the filter should be replaced. The filter must be replaced in the event fluids have been in contact with the filter, such as in a collection
container overflow.
• Do not disassemble the unit; there are no user-serviceable components inside the device. If repair or servicing is required, please send unit to an
authorized service center. Disassembly or tampering of the device will damage the device and void the warranty.
WARNING
• Prior to cleaning, make sure machine is turned off and unplugged.
• To ensure proper hygiene, collection container, inline filter, suction tubing, and intermediate tubing must only be used by the same patient.
Do not use these accessories across multiple patients. Do not attempt to sterilize these accessories for use across multiple patients. Failure to abide
by these warnings may result in infection or cross contamination between patients.
• Any parts or the device or accessories that come into contact with bodily secretions must be cleaned after each suction operation. All single-use
accessories, such as the suction catheter, must be disposed of according to local regulations, institution policy (as applicable) and the instructions
of a certified healthcare professional.
• Wear disposable gloves during cleaning procedures.
Cleaning the surface of the unit
• Clean the surface of the unit after each use. Wipe machine clean with a damp cloth.
• Do not clean machine with powder-type cleaning agents or soap.
• Do not clean machine in water.
WARNING: If the inside of the unit comes into direct contact with liquids, the aspirator must be sent to an authorized service center for
examination and repair.
ATTENTION: Slight discoloration of plastic housing or the stickers on the housing may occur over time. This will not impact the performance or
function of the device.
Cleaning reusable accessories
• Clean the collection container after each use. Empty contents and wash all components using a mixture of 3 parts white vinegar 1 part warm tap
water.
• Clean intermediate and suction tubing after each use. Disconnect tubing from machine and clean by rinsing inside and outside of tubing with hot
tap water. Air dry.
• Clean the collection container coaster after each use. Rinse with hot tap water and air dry.
WARNING
• To ensure proper hygiene, collection container, inline filter, suction tubing, and intermediate tubing must only be used by the same patient.
Do not use these accessories across multiple patients. Do not attempt to sterilize these accessories for use across multiple patients. Failure to abide
by these warnings may result in infection or cross contamination between patients.
• Fluid collected in the collection container must be disposed of according to local regulations, institution policy (as applicable), and the instructions
of a certified healthcare professional.
CAUTION: Do not immerse inline filter in liquid. Doing so will damage the filter. If the fibrous material inside the inline filter is wet, replace
immediately.

Transportation, Storage, and Disposal
Transportation
• General transportation of the unit should correspond to the conditions outlined in the 'Product Introduction' section of this manual.
• In the event that the AS-1001D suction pump needs to be sent to an authorized service center for inspection and repair, do not package the
collection container, suction tubing, inline filter, intermediate tubing, collection container coaster, or any single-use accessories (such as a
suction catheter) in the shipment.
Storage
Storage of the AS-1001D suction pump should correspond to the conditions outlined in the "Product Introduction" section of this manual.
Disposal
• When the product’s life cycle is at an end, all components of the unit must be disposed of in accordance with local regulations.
• Take care that the unit is clean and that the various materials are carefully separated for disposal.
• The European Union (EU) directives 2012/19/EU, known as the WEEE (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ment) Directive, and 2011/65/EU, referred
to as the RoHS (Restrictions on Hazardous Substances) Directive prohibits the disposal of this device in the domestic waste.
• Outside the EU: Follow disposal regulations in the country of use.
